Butterfly Valve vs. Ball Valve: Which is Best for Natural Gas?

Apr. 09, 2025

When it comes to controlling the flow of natural gas, choosing the right valve can significantly impact performance and safety. Two commonly used valve types are butterfly valves and ball valves. Each has its own advantages and disadvantages in different applications. Below is a comparison of these two types of valves, specifically in the context of natural gas usage.

1. What is a Butterfly Valve?

A butterfly valve is a quarter-turn valve that uses a rotating disk to stop or start the flow of fluid. It is generally used for on-off control. The disk is mounted on a shaft, and when the handle is turned, the disk rotates. This rotation allows the valve to either block or allow the passage of gas.

2. What is a Ball Valve?

A ball valve uses a spherical ball with a hole through it to control the flow. When the ball is turned so that the hole is aligned with the pipe, the flow can pass through. When turned perpendicular to the flow, the ball blocks the passage. Ball valves are known for their reliability and ability to create a tight seal.

3. What are the Advantages of Using a Butterfly Valve for Natural Gas?

Butterfly valves have several advantages when used in natural gas applications:

  1. Lightweight and Compact: Butterfly valves are generally lighter than ball valves, making them easier to install and operate.
  2. Quick Operation: They can be opened or closed with a simple quarter-turn, allowing for rapid control of gas flow.
  3. Cost-Effective: Butterfly valves are usually less expensive to manufacture and purchase compared to ball valves, which can make them a more economical choice in large systems.
  4. Space-Saving Design: Their slim profile makes them ideal for situations where space is limited.

4. What are the Advantages of Using a Ball Valve for Natural Gas?

Ball valves also have their set of benefits:

  1. Sealing Capability: Ball valves provide a better sealing capability, essential for preventing leaks in gas lines.
  2. Durability: They are built to withstand high pressures and temperatures, making them suitable for varying natural gas conditions.
  3. Smooth Operation: The spherical shape of the ball allows for minimal friction, which translates to easy opening and closing.
  4. Long Lifespan: Due to their robust construction, ball valves typically have a longer operational life than butterfly valves.

5. Which Valve is Better for Natural Gas Applications?

Choosing between a butterfly valve and a ball valve for natural gas applications depends largely on the specific requirements of the system:

  1. If space and weight are concerns: A butterfly valve may be the better choice due to its compact design.
  2. If you need a strong seal: A ball valve is generally more efficient in preventing leaks and would be advisable in critical applications.
  3. If budget is a primary concern: Butterfly valves offer a cost-saving advantage.
  4. If durability and high-pressure performance are needed: A ball valve typically outperforms a butterfly valve in these scenarios.

6. Conclusion: Which is Right for Your Needs?

In summary, both butterfly and ball valves have their pros and cons when it comes to handling natural gas. The butterfly valve is beneficial for its lightweight, quick operation, and cost-effectiveness. On the other hand, the ball valve excels in durability and sealing capabilities. Evaluating your specific use case will help you determine the best option for your natural gas systems.
